## What Is Plain Text?
Plain text refers to a straightforward, unformatted text file that contains readable characters without any additional styling, such as bold or italics. It is often the backbone for various data management and sharing scenarios across tech, finance, and healthcare sectors. As communication demands increase, the ability to generate, share, and manipulate data with minimal complexity becomes increasingly vital. Think of plain text as the common language in a global meeting: simple, universally understood, and essential for clarity.
## How Plain Text Works in Practice
### 1. GitHub Repositories
GitHub, the platform where developers worldwide collaborate on open-source projects, leans heavily on plain text. According to the GitHub State of the Octoverse 2022, 68% of repositories utilized plain text files. This preference stems from their ease in tracking changes and managing version control, allowing teams to revert to prior iterations easily. This widespread adoption underscores the necessity of simplicity in code collaboration—a cornerstone of effective software development.
